Taxonomic Classification

Rank Black-capped Marmot Pale tortoise beetle
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Insecta (Insects)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Coleoptera (Beetles)
Family Sciuridae (Squirrels) Chrysomelidae
Genus Marmota Cassida
Species Marmota camtschatica Cassida flaveola
